#7d0c07 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#7d0c07 is composed of 49% red, 4.7% green and 2.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 90.4% magenta, 94.4% yellow and 51% black. It has a hue angle of 2.5 degrees, a saturation of 89.4% and a lightness of 25.9%. #7d0c07 color hex could be obtained by blending #fa180e with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#660000.

#7d0c07 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#7d0c07 has RGB values of R:125, G:12, B:7 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.9, Y:0.94, K:0.51. Its decimal value is 8195079.
